Joan B. Hirt is a scholar working on Education, Political Science and International Relations and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Joan B. Hirt has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 664 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Education, 6 papers in Political Science and International Relations and 6 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Joan B. Hirt's work include Higher Education Research Studies (20 papers), Higher Education Governance and Development (6 papers) and Online and Blended Learning (4 papers). Joan B. Hirt is often cited by papers focused on Higher Education Research Studies (20 papers), Higher Education Governance and Development (6 papers) and Online and Blended Learning (4 papers). Joan B. Hirt collaborates with scholars based in United States, Greece and Austria. Joan B. Hirt's co-authors include Ane Turner Johnson, Catherine Amelink, Terrell L. Strayhorn, Eric Williams, Yasuo Miyazaki, Roger B. Winston, Steven M. Janosik, Don G. Creamer, James H. Murray and E. A. Williams and has published in prestigious journals such as Higher Education, Journal of college student development and Review of higher education/˜The œreview of higher education.
